多台服务器运行一个网站可以吗,多台服务器协同运行网站,技术实现与优势分析
- 综合资讯
- 2025-04-04 10:40:36
- 2

多台服务器协同运行一个网站是可行的,通过负载均衡和集群技术,可以实现高可用性和负载分散,技术优势包括提高网站稳定性、提升访问速度、增强可扩展性,并有效应对高并发访问。...
多台服务器协同运行一个网站是可行的,通过负载均衡和集群技术,可以实现高可用性和负载分散,技术优势包括提高网站稳定性、提升访问速度、增强可扩展性,并有效应对高并发访问。
随着互联网的快速发展,网站已经成为企业、机构和个人展示自身形象、提供信息和服务的重要平台,随着访问量的不断攀升,单台服务器已经无法满足大规模网站的需求,为了确保网站的稳定性和高性能,多台服务器协同运行成为了一种常见的解决方案,本文将探讨多台服务器运行一个网站的技术实现和优势分析。
图片来源于网络,如有侵权联系删除
多台服务器运行网站的技术实现
负载均衡
负载均衡是实现多台服务器协同运行网站的关键技术之一,通过负载均衡,可以将访问请求均匀分配到多台服务器上,避免单台服务器过载,提高网站的响应速度和稳定性,常见的负载均衡技术有:
(1)DNS轮询:通过DNS解析将访问请求分配到不同的服务器IP地址。
(2)硬件负载均衡器:使用专门的硬件设备进行负载均衡,如F5 BIG-IP。
(3)软件负载均衡器:利用软件实现负载均衡,如Nginx、HAProxy等。
数据库集群
数据库是网站的核心组成部分,多台服务器协同运行网站时,数据库集群技术尤为重要,数据库集群技术可以将数据分散存储在多台服务器上,提高数据库的读写性能和可靠性,常见的数据库集群技术有:
(1)主从复制:将数据同步到多台服务器,实现读写分离。
(2)分片存储:将数据按照一定规则分散存储在多台服务器上。
(3)分布式数据库:将数据库拆分为多个部分,分别存储在多台服务器上。
内容分发网络(CDN)
CDN可以将网站内容缓存到全球各地的节点服务器上,当用户访问网站时,可以从距离最近的服务器获取内容,从而提高访问速度和降低带宽成本,CDN技术主要包括以下几种:
(1)边缘计算:在用户访问网站时,将部分计算任务分配到边缘节点服务器上。
(2)缓存策略:根据用户访问行为,对网站内容进行缓存。
图片来源于网络,如有侵权联系删除
分发:将网站内容分发到全球各地的节点服务器上。
多台服务器运行网站的优势分析
提高网站性能
多台服务器协同运行网站,可以将访问请求均匀分配到每台服务器上,降低单台服务器的负载,提高网站的响应速度和并发处理能力。
提高网站稳定性
当一台服务器出现故障时,其他服务器可以继续提供服务,确保网站的稳定运行,通过负载均衡技术,可以避免单台服务器过载,降低故障风险。
降低运维成本
多台服务器协同运行网站,可以实现资源的合理分配和利用,降低硬件设备的采购和维护成本,通过自动化运维工具,可以简化运维工作,提高运维效率。
提高用户体验
多台服务器协同运行网站,可以降低用户访问延迟,提高网站内容的加载速度,从而提升用户体验。
支持业务扩展
随着业务的发展,网站需要不断扩展功能和服务,多台服务器协同运行网站,可以方便地进行横向扩展,满足业务增长需求。
多台服务器协同运行网站是一种有效的解决方案,可以提高网站性能、稳定性和可扩展性,在实际应用中,应根据网站需求和资源状况,选择合适的负载均衡、数据库集群和CDN等技术,实现多台服务器协同运行网站。
本文链接:https://www.zhitaoyun.cn/1998830.html
发表评论